Transaction 37a07b886f3a59d8d02597064b36bf172eb253e378c981a973f3aa593ea72e70
2 Input
2 Outputs
- 37a07b886f3a59d8d02597064b36bf172eb253e378c981a973f3aa593ea72e70:0
- 37a07b886f3a59d8d02597064b36bf172eb253e378c981a973f3aa593ea72e70:1
value 112618
address 38NRcHhABvXE3ndzSrtJGHZDMcHBi7F7cM
value 59659
address 12Bat3bwGZYANiJU4c4Ak3D46YoUctoLas